Poplar Long Plate Sprung Door Knob & Thumbturn - Antique Brass
Our Poplar design is our take on the classic Victorian beehive knob.
We’ve streamlined things, giving it a flatter knob and, in this case, a low-profile, long backplate and built-in thumbturn. It’ll work well in period properties with a contemporary edge, or by bringing a traditional touch to new builds.
The knob is sprung, which means you don’t need to rely on the latch’s spring for its movement. We’ve opted for a light spring, so it takes very little effort to turn.
There’s also no danger of it coming away in your hand – we’ve engineered the backplate and knob to be inseparable.
Antique brass is what’s called a ‘living’ finish because it reacts to the air and moisture around it, causing it to darken (especially in the areas you touch most). We’ve given it a head start by ageing it by hand, so it has that antique look right out the box.
- Made from solid brass
- 4mm backplate with screwless ‘front’ side
- Super smooth turn thanks to self-lubricating, high-tolerance bushings
- Longer handle neck for a comfortable grip
- Designed for use with tubular latches and locks, or mortice locks
- Engineered to fit all standard door thicknesses
- When retrofitting, you’ll need to use our door handle installation tool
- Suitable for interior and exterior doors
- Sold in a pair
